Moderately steep, but narrow, deeply washed out, rocky, rooty and always small "steps" or drops. You have to want to do it and have a bit of practice to make it fun. It's more for trail bikes or even enduro, although the enduro riders can probably laugh about it wearily 😅

Legal bike trail starts at the parking lot by the sports field directly to the right of the pump track. very nice, well-maintained route with lots of berms and several jumps, all of which can be rolled over or bypassed👍

Yes, several bike parks in the Altensteig region cater to beginners. For instance, Bikemaster Trail Nagold has sections where obstacles can be avoided or rolled over. Similarly, Bikemaster Trail Section 3 offers easier alternatives alongside its main trail, making it suitable for less experienced riders, even those with hardtails. The Bikemaster Trail Nagold is also noted for being beautifully laid out and suitable for beginners.
The bike parks around Altensteig offer diverse terrain, from flowy sections with berms and tables for airtime to more challenging parts with kickers, stone fields, and steep turns. You'll find a mix of natural and designed features, including narrow, rooted singletracks and trails with long jumps and flowing curves. The region is characterized by its dense forests and rolling hills, providing a scenic backdrop for your ride.
Experienced mountain bikers will find challenging trails in Altensteig. The lower half of Bikemaster Trail Nagold, for example, is more challenging with flow trails, kickers, and stone fields. The Technical Root Trail to Zaverlsteiner Brückle – Rötelbachtal is described as demanding, with narrow, rooted, and sometimes steep sections and drops. The Black Forest Trail, mentioned in regional research, also offers challenging single trails with steep slopes.
Yes, the region aims to be accessible for all skill levels, including families. Many trails, such as Bikemaster Trail Section 3, provide easier alternatives, ensuring that less experienced riders can also enjoy the experience. The overall infrastructure and varied trails mean that families can find suitable options for different skill levels.
Summer is ideal for dry trails and pleasant temperatures. However, spring and autumn are generally recommended for cycling tours due to milder weather and beautiful scenery. Autumn, in particular, transforms the Black Forest into a 'veritable sea of colours,' enhancing the biking experience. Be aware that some tracks, like Bikemaster Trail Section 3, may be closed in December and January for game protection.
Yes, for some trails, like Bikemaster Trail Section 3, there are specific rules. These include helmet duty and a strict no-smoking policy on the entire route. This particular track is also closed during December and January for game protection. Trails are generally open from one hour after sunrise to one hour before sunset.
